In the modern era, enterprises that leverage digital transformation primarily conduct their operations online and in real-time, minimizing the need for human involvement. While this strategy significantly lowers expenses and enhances customer satisfaction, it simultaneously opens the door to substantial risks of fraud perpetrated by savvy individuals who exploit the online environment's inherent anonymity and ease of access. For instance, in the realm of e-commerce, fraudulent transactions can arise from hacked accounts and pilfered payment information. Additionally, various forms of deception may include account takeovers, misuse of complimentary trials, fake reviews for products, warranty abuses, refund scams, reseller fraud, and exploitation of discount programs. These fraudulent actions can severely impact both the bottom line and the brand reputation of the business. Unlike in the early days of the internet, today's fraudulent schemes are often executed by organized, well-funded groups of professionals who are adept at navigating online systems. The evolving landscape of cyber threats necessitates a proactive approach to safeguard against these sophisticated fraud tactics.

Telecom fraud results in a staggering loss of nearly $40 billion for companies worldwide each year. A single case of fraudulent international calls can result in a substantial financial blow, costing around $50,000. Traditional manual processes are often cumbersome and fail to provide the necessary automation to swiftly identify and prevent fraud. Protector stands out as the leading fraud management system in the United States, designed through extensive experience and continuous improvements. Now in its 11th generation, this robust and adaptable solution draws on decades of expertise in fraud risk mitigation across numerous carriers. With Protector, you can effectively halt ongoing fraud, quickly investigate and resolve incidents, and achieve a significant and prompt return on investment. Enhancing its support for rapid ROI, Protector seamlessly integrates with the PRISM database of IRSF test numbers, enabling proactive blocking of IRSF attacks before they escalate. Additionally, it empowers users to pinpoint and assess suspicious network activities.
